The article entitled "Life on Earth" is trying to make the point that RNA likely included before DNA. Forthis article which of the following is false?
A. Chains of RNA nucleotides can form spontaneously on mineral surfaces.
B. The polynucleotide RNA chains can create a duplex and is twisted into a double helix in a manner very similar to DNA
C. Certain RNA nucleotide chains can fold upon themselves and adopt conformations that permit for them to catalyze chemical reactions.
D. Short RNA molecules can self-replicate if given with a catalyst.
